Overview

About this course

UCL is proud to launch Sri Lanka's first British Masters Degree in Digital Marketing Communications. The programme is designed for individuals passionate about elevating their expertise in digital marketing and caters to a diverse audience seeking to advance their careers in the rapidly evolving digital landscape. This programme provides a comprehensive grounding in digital marketing communication strategy, consumer psychology, and applied social media marketing. Students develop both theoretical knowledge and practical skills, culminating in an independent research project on a topic of their choosing within the field of digital marketing.

Course Structure

Contemporary Digital Communications

BM4000 • Core

Develops understanding of digital marketing communication theory and practice, identifying strategic issues and evaluating opportunities for improved communication within complex customer ecosystems.

Digital Marketing and Applied Social Media Marketing Strategies

BM4001 • Core

Investigates strategic approach of digital marketing within the business environment, including social media and search engine marketing/optimization.

Consumer Psychology in the Digital Era

BM4002 • Core

Provides introduction to consumer behaviour from psychological perspective and explores its relation to online consumer society.

Critical Thinking Skills for Postgraduate Study

BM4019 • Core

Develops postgraduate study and learning skills within academic context, encouraging learners to apply critical thinking, learning skills, and reflective practices.

Research Project

BM4200 • Core

Final research project completed on a topic of student's interest in digital marketing. Equips students to independently plan and conduct research projects.
